Delving into Mobile 4G Proxies
With the increasing need for online anonymity, mobile 4G proxies have become essential for bypassing geo-restrictions.
An Overview of 4G Rotating Proxies
These proxies utilize mobile networks to provide changing IPs to users. Unlike static proxies, they change IP addresses periodically, reducing detection risks.
Operational Dynamics
Once initiated, a dynamic IP from a mobile network is provided. These IPs are switched periodically, hindering surveillance.
Why Opt for 4G Rotating Proxies
- Improved Privacy: Dynamic IP rotation masks real IP addresses.
- Bypassing Geo-Restrictions: Changing IPs facilitate unrestricted browsing.
- Reduced IP Bans: Frequent IP changes prevent bans.
Applications of 4G Rotating Proxies
- Data Extraction: Rotating IPs prevent scraping blocks.proxies support multiple profiles.
- Ad Verification: Changing IPs simulate diverse user locations.

== What is a 4G Rotating Proxy?
A 4G rotating proxy is a proxy that routes internet traffic through a real mobile device. These proxies change IPs at custom timeframes or upon request, emulating human behavior and eliminating the risk of bans or blocks.
== Main Proxy Types
Let’s look at the key proxy types before comparing:
1. **Datacenter Proxies**
– High-speed and cheap, but easily detectable.
2. **Residential Proxies**
– Use IPs assigned to real homes. More reliable, but slower and costlier.
3. **4G Mobile Proxies**
– Use real SIMs on LTE networks. Best for scraping, bots, social media.
4. **SOCKS5 Proxies**
– Protocol-based, flexible, used for various apps, not just HTTP.
== Comparison Table
| Feature | 4G Rotating Proxies | Datacenter Proxies | Residential Proxies | SOCKS5 Proxies |
|————————|———————|———————|———————|—————-|
| IP Source | Mobile Network (SIM)| Data Centers | Home IPs | Varies |
| Rotation | Yes (Frequent) | Sometimes | Optional | Manual |
| Ban Resistance | High | Low | Medium | Depends |
| Speed | Medium | High | Low-Medium | High |
| Price | High | Low | Medium | Low-Medium |
| Target Use | Social, Ads, Bots | General Scraping | E-commerce, Research| General |
| Block Detection | Low | High | Medium | Medium |
== Technical Advantages of 4G Rotating Proxies
Why are 4G proxies so powerful?
– **Real Device Trust**: Websites trust mobile IPs more than others due to carrier NAT and wide user pools.
– **Shared Reputation**: IPs are shared across many users, making banning a single user risky.
– **Geo-targeted Mobile Carriers**: Rotate between networks in real U.S. cities or countries.
– **Dynamic Rotation**: Can rotate every few minutes or after each request.
– **Bypasses Captchas**: Mobile IPs are less likely to trigger captchas or challenge verifications.
